Abstract

Computer algebra systems, like Macaulay 2 [80], Singular [47], and CoCoA [39], have become essential tools for many mathematicians in commutative algebra and algebraic geometry. These systems provide a “laboratory” in which we can experiment and play with new ideas. From these experiments, a researcher can formulate new conjectures, and hopefully, new theorems. Computer algebra systems are especially good at dealing with monomial ideals. As a consequence, the study of edge and cover ideals is well suited to experiments using computer algebra systems.
